Finance Review Summary — Ostrevale Expansion, Calder & Pym Ltd.

Entry into the Ostrevale region is fundable from existing reserves. Lease commitments modest; breakeven projected within six quarters. Main risk: local licensing delays. Recommendation: proceed, phased rollout, two sites first. Board approval requested at next sitting. The underlying commercial reasoning is set out below.

internal memo for faweg-tafog: Only 7 of the 100 pilot accounts renewed Quenael, so a churn review is set for April 15.

## Ownership

The BounceSift service processes inbound bounce notifications for the Mailwren platform, classifies them as hard or soft, and updates suppression lists. Reviewers should note that classification rules live in `rules/bounce.yaml` and are versioned separately from the service code. Changes to suppression behavior require an extra review pass, since mistakes affect deliverability across all tenants. Merge rights on the rules file are restricted. Review requests and escalations go to the owner named below.

named custodian: Brivan Eliath Quenox Frador

POSTMORTEM TIMELINE — Restok Planner outage

14:22 — Planner at Quillhaven Vending emitted empty restock routes for all northern depots. Cause: a schema change dropped the machine-capacity column, so every slot read as full. Detected by a driver report, not alerting. Rolled back at 15:05; backfilled routes by 15:40. The regressing artifact is recorded below for reference.

pipeline stamp: htk9_b3279b371

Prod and staging have diverged. Watering windows on prod were hand-edited during the heatwave incident and never backported. Plugin authors: assume staging values are canonical until this closes. Symptoms: schedules firing 40 min early for plugins using the zone-offset hook, and the moisture-threshold override being silently ignored. Do not ship plugins that hardcode window boundaries. Remediation is to re-render prod from the template repo and lock manual edits. For reference, the canonical configuration values are as follows.

service settings:
pelath:
  pin: 5871
  tenant: belox
  seal: seal_d5a7bfb2
  metrics_host: metrics.pelath.qorvelcorp.test
  standby_team: oliys
  escalation: kelath-nordor
  nonce: 338058